Your laugh strikes me as a blow to the chest
Your stance shrivels as a taunt
Snickering behind icy warm eyes
You suffocate
I watch until my eyes
Bleed pain from the consistence
Of undying sadness
You chase him
You follow him
Even whispers flutter from each of their lips
My legs beaten
Mouth covered in grey tape
Strapped to the chair of
Silence
He’s comforted and I’m clanking my teeth
Trying to breathe warmth on my hands
I want to scream
But lose my words in my underpass
One way mirror directed towards you
You don’t connect but pass by without a wince in your eye
Pitter patter
Stomping
All swirls around me as I feel you walk away
